While vaccination rates for residents ages 12 to 17 and over 65 are above 90%, the rates for those in the middle are lagging. Just 73% of residents ages 25 to 34 — the bulk of millennials— are fully vaccinated, making them the least vaccinated age group among those who are eligible in the city.
San Francisco’s announcement comes as the dangerous delta variant of the coronavirus continues to take hold across the country.
